IRE vs ZIM Live: Rain Delays Toss as Zimbabwe Eye Super 8s

New Delhi [India], February 17: Rain at the Pallekele International Cricket Stadium has postponed the toss of the Ireland vs Zimbabwe match in the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up 2026, throwing a crucial Group B fixture into doubt. With qualification stakes high and weather dictating terms, the focus has shifted from team combinations to day-to-day conditions in Pallekele. This weather could play a bigger role than the bat or the ball.

What is the reason behind the IRE vs ZIM toss being postponed at Pallekele today?

Continuous morning rainfall across central Sri Lanka has disrupted pre-match preparations at Pallekele. The outfield remains wet, and match officials are closely monitoring conditions before setting a revised start time. Although the venue’s drainage system is among the best in the region, persistent rain has kept the covers firmly in place.

As fans track the IRE vs ZIM Live Score page, officials are expected to conduct periodic inspections. Any further showers could result in a reduction of overs, increasing volatility in an already tight Group B.

What is on the line in T20 World Cup 2026 Group B?

This match carries significant implications for the T20 World Cup 2026 Group B standings. Zimbabwe currently sit on four points, placing them in a strong position to progress. A win today would secure their place in the Super Eight stage. Crucially, even a washout would be enough for Zimbabwe to qualify, as a no-result would add a point to their tally.

Ireland, meanwhile, are fighting to keep their campaign alive and to influence the final standings. For Ireland, these points are not only vital for progression but also for reshaping the qualification equation involving other teams in the group.

What is the fate of Australia if the match is cancelled?

Australia would be the most affected side in the event of a washout. If the Ireland vs Zimbabwe match is abandoned, Australia will be eliminated from the tournament.

Here is why. Based on their remaining fixtures, Australia can reach a maximum of four points in Group B. If Zimbabwe gain even one point from a no-result today, they will move ahead on points, leaving Australia without a mathematical route to the Super Eight. In simple terms, Australia’s qualification scenarios depend entirely on this match producing a result that goes against Zimbabwe.

This makes the weather the most influential factor in Group B, outweighing form, strategy, and on-field match-ups.

What is the impact of weather on modern match dynamics?

From an expert perspective, the assessment is straightforward and predictable: the weather is currently the biggest player in Group B. Rain interruptions can compress games into five- or ten-over contests, where variance increases sharply and the advantage of winning the toss is amplified.

If playing conditions are revised, teams will need to adapt quickly. In shortened matches, powerplay efficiency, boundary-hitting, and death-over execution become more critical than longer tactical plans. However, until play actually begins, none of these considerations matter.

For now, Pallekele weather today remains the dominant storyline. Forecasts suggest intermittent showers rather than a full-day washout, but conditions in Sri Lanka’s hill country can change rapidly.

What are the possible scenarios if play begins?

If play gets underway with reduced overs, Zimbabwe are likely to approach the match with clarity and discipline. Knowing that even a narrow loss could still leave other teams dependent on results, they may prioritize control over risk.

Ireland, on the other hand, would benefit from an aggressive strategy. Early wickets or a fast start could swing a shortened contest dramatically in their favor. Whenever it happens, the toss could prove decisive, particularly if Duckworth-Lewis-Stern calculations come into play.

In a full 20-over match, Pallekele conditions traditionally assist seamers early before settling into a more balanced surface. Rain, however, can alter grip and pace, introducing another layer of uncertainty.

Why does this match matter beyond Group B standings?

Beyond immediate qualification outcomes, this fixture highlights the narrow margins of tournament cricket. For Australia, one of the game’s traditional powerhouses, elimination without taking the field would underline how scheduling and weather can derail campaigns.

For Zimbabwe, progression would mark another milestone in its steady resurgence on the global stage. For Ireland, influencing the fate of the group reinforces their reputation as a competitive and credible T20 side.
